Academically speaking, I still find the whole âanti-shipperâ movement to be fascinating from a sociological perspective.
You have what amounts to a extremist purity cult whose beliefs align nearly precisely with those of Conservative American Christianity in terms of sexual purity politics (admittedly with some additional flourishes that Iâve watched develop in real time), but is mostly composed of minority members whose sexual-and-gender identities are opposed and oppressed by Conservative American Christianity. Additionally, their tactics also mirror religious pro-censorship groups (such as Warriors For Innocence), but their rhetoric is entirely secularized and derived from leftist theory.
Did they arrive at this structure via convergent evolution? Â Via socially dominant concepts in the greater socio-cultural space that they occupy? Â I doubt it was by direct emulation but the possibility does exist on some levels.
Iâm literally doing my sociology research paper on them right now.
Ooh? Go on.
Itâs a qualitative study looking at the ways that Tumblr antis define the word âpedophiliaâ. Itâs pretty interesting stuff because the definitions are so unique to Tumblr anti culture. Iâll have to go through my coding more thoroughly, but I think Iâve broken them down into four categories:
1. Legality based arguments where theyâre very stuck on the idea of Age of Majority. Usually these people believe that itâs pedophilia if an 18 year old dates a 17 year old because they view age 18 as a hard and fast line from childhood to adulthood.
2. Psychological-readiness based arguments are a lot more subjective. These people often use arguments about differing life stages as a reason to call something pedophilia. Some even bust out that âpeoples brains donât fully age until 25â factoid. For this group, age gaps are a real no-go, even if both partners are legally consenting adults. The acceptablity of age gaps varied.
3. Physical appearance based arguments are focused against people who like young looking or young acting characters, even if those characters are adults. These people define pedophilia as an attraction to the perception of youth. This belief is strongly correlated with anti-DD/LG posting.
4. Iâm having trouble naming the fourth category. Itâs based around an argument of sneaky pedophilia or maybe an uncovering of the fan creators hidden desires? These antis argue that aging up characters past canon ages and shipping them is pedophilia because they believe that the shipper REALLY wanted to ship the child but didnât because they were worried it wasnât socially acceptable. In this instance, the character is portrayed as an adult by fandom and there is nothing childish in their appearance or mannerism. Because the character was depicted as a child in canon, however, the anti believes that the character must always be depicted that way in fandom and that only tricky pedophiles would be interested in exploring that characterâs future.
Similarly, I noticed a newer trend of calling adult ships between people who canonically knew each other as children/teens to be called pedophilia or at the very least jailbaity, predatory behaviour. This is particularly true when the characters are a couple years apart. The idea there is that, if they knew each other as children, theyâd never be able to see each other as adults. So if they have sex as adults, theyâre mentally thinking of the child version of their partner and are therefore a pedophile. I wonder if this is a projection of the beliefs from #4. Perhaps it is the antis who, once introduced to a child/teen, are never able to see them as anything but a child and therefore they believe that everyone else must feel the same? Thatâs only a guess. I only saw this one a handful of times and it was all pretty recently, so I didnât include it in the data for my paper. It does seem to indicate a level of escalation in these definitions though. Iâll have to check in again at a later date and see if it sticks around.
Iâve seen all of those as well, and Iâd be fascinated to see your results when youâre published.
As for names for the fourth category, can I suggest Canonical Stasis arguments? As in, âthe characters are forever frozen at the ages that they are presentedâ.

I was originally thinking something similar. Thatâs why I had written it down as âsneaky pedophileâ at first. lol Upon further reflection, however, I think that canonical stasis is more accurate. That pedophiles have specific tells and that aging up is an attempt to subvert those tells is the argument. The underlying belief for that to work, however, is that canonical ages must remain static. Otherwise the argument falls apart.Â
That is similar to the reason I went with a psychological readiness label for #2. Originally I had just put down âage gapsâ, but age gap only encompasses the argument. The underlying belief for the problematic elements of age gaps is that one partner is psychologically/emotionally unready for the relationship. This strikes at the core of the concern, which is the perceived power imbalance between the partners. This power imbalance is then sometimes conflated with pedophilia. Age gaps are just one of the ways this is expressed. Other arguments in a similar vein are that the characters are in differing life stages or that the characters brain is not yet fully developed (some psychological studies suggest that the human brain is still developing up until age 25, so some people argue that people under 25 are still too young for relationships with older adults).
